как мне установить GKSU или другую программу для редактирования от имени пользователя root, чтобы сохранить изменения в файле grub в / etc / default, чтобы разрешить загрузку nomodeset? [дубликат]

Запрос от 20 марта 2019 г.

В ноябре я получил ответ на Как исправить зависший черный экран на Запуск Lubuntu? от Карела для консультации https: // askubuntu.com / tags / nomodeset / info

Сначала я открыл grub из etc / default и изменил:

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"

на:

GRUB_CMDLINE_LINUX_DEFAULT="nomodeset"

Но это не позволило мне сохранить изменения! Он открыл его в блокноте, но у меня не было разрешений!

В следующем комментарии Карела предлагалось запустить его как root, чтобы получить разрешение с помощью этой команды в терминале:

sudo nano /etc/default/grub

Я уверен, что большинство из них порекомендовали бы ознакомиться с терминалом. Я понял это, потому что изменил его (стрелки на клавиатуре только для навигации, без щелчков мышью!), И после выхода из него мне было предложено сохранить, что я и сделал, а затем запустил `sudo update grub после этого, как и вики, и Карел сказали .

Я искал больше по этой теме и нашел Как редактировать файл GRUB в / etc / default / , где в 2013 году кто-то рекомендовал использовать что-то под названием gksu для редактирования от имени пользователя root. Это все еще есть? Я не смог найти его в Synaptic Package Manager, когда искал.

Я ищу альтернативные средства редактирования root (возможно, через Leadpad, именно так grub открывается по умолчанию, когда я дважды щелкнул по нему), которые немного проще для глаз и ума, чем редактирование в терминале.

А пока я собираюсь перезагрузиться и посмотреть, исправит ли это ситуацию. Кто-нибудь знает о проблеме, поднятой в . Как добавить строки в / etc / default / grub, чтобы они отражались в /boot/grub/grub.cfg?, и есть ли какие-то особые соображения для / загрузка / grub / grub.cfg? при выборе графических драйверов для запуска при запуске?

Я получаю это сообщение, когда выполняю «Дополнительные параметры», а затем «Режим восстановления», а затем «Возобновить загрузку»

. Некоторым графическим драйверам требуется полная графическая загрузка, поэтому они не работают при возобновлении после восстановления

я предполагаю, что выполнение этого 'nomodeset' аналогично, за исключением того, что драйверы не выходят из строя, они вообще не пытаются инициировать, поэтому я мог бы выполнить обычный запуск. Я попробую это сейчас и обновлю с результатами.

0
задан 19 March 2019 в 23:28

1 ответ

gksu удерживается от использования и больше не доступный.

Многие люди рекомендуют инструменты командной строки для задач администрирования, например

sudo nano filename

Но если Вам действительно нужна программа с графическим интерфейсом пользователя, существуют решения:

  • Если программа подготовлена к нему

    GUI-program
    

    или выберите программу с помощью меню или dash и Вам предложат пароль

  • pkexec GUI-program

  • sudo -H GUI-program


Никогда не используйте плоскость sudo GUI-program потому что это может повредить конфигурационные файлы Вашего идентификатора пользователя.


При использовании Уэйленда (вместо старого Xorg), существует больше сложности, описанной в следующей ссылке,

Почему не делают gksu/gksudo или запуск графического приложения с sudo работают с Уэйлендом?

1
ответ дан 26 October 2019 в 00:26

Другие вопросы по тегам:

Похожие вопросы: